I used to have that issue here as well, with the grabber RX normally set to 135.5 kHz USB. Newer versions of WSPR (2.0) will allow you to select a different the BFO frequency (Setup - Advanced menue, eg. 2000 Hz). Keep in mind that the new version switches the soundcard to 48 ks/s samplerate rather than 12 ks/s, which did not work on my older laptop due to incorrect timing.
